The 4-Dimension Scorecard
Nearly $30k in revenue despite a sub-4.0 rating proves the 'Missed Call' pain point is massive and underserved.
A 3.69 rating with 49 reviews is a flashing red light of incompetence. The incumbent is vulnerable to a stable competitor.
LTD models for AI voice (Vapi/Retell/ElevenLabs wrappers) are a race to bankruptcy. $0.20/min margins are thin for a lifetime commitment.
Crowded space (Thoughtly, Air AI), but most competitors are failing on the 'basics' like number activation and latency.

Execution Plan
“Build a 'Reliability-First' voice agent. Dialora is failing on the plumbing (Twilio/Telnyx integrations); win by making number porting instant and the AI logic 100% deterministic for appointment booking.”
Build First
- Instant Number Provisioning (API-first)
- Deterministic Booking Flow (No hallucination)
- Bring Your Own Key (BYOK) for AI/Voice to solve sustainability
Do Not Start With
- Built-in CRM (Use webhooks instead)
- Outbound Cold Calling (High regulatory risk/spam)
